List of highest ranked tennis players per country
This article lists the professional tennis players who reached the highest ranking among their compatriots during the Open Era. The rankings used are ATP Rankings for men (since 23 August 1973 for singles, and 1 March 1976 for doubles) and WTA Rankings for women (since 3 November 1975 for singles, and 4 September 1984 for doubles).
On 11 September 2017, Garbiñe Muguruza and Rafael Nadal made Spain the first country since the United States 14 years ago to simultaneously top both the ATP and the WTA rankings, with Muguruza making her debut in the No. 1 spot. The most recent previous such pair were Serena Williams and Andre Agassi, 28 April to 11 May, 2003.[1]

- Matt Doyle ranked world number 56 in 1983. He represented Ireland in the Davis Cup from 1981 but did not acquire Irish nationality until 1985.
